Washington State Accuses 2 Cryptocurrency Platforms of Defrauding Investors

Two cryptocurrency platforms face allegations of fraud by Washington State’s Department of Financial Institutions. Both companies allegedly lured investors with promises of huge returns, but later blocked withdrawals and demanded extra fees. Nigeria to Launch $1.5M Initiative to Boost AI Development

Nigeria’s Minister of Communications, Innovation, and Digital Economy, Bosun Tijani, has announced a $1.5 million initiative to boost the country’s Artificial Intelligence (AI) development. 4 Arrests, Sanctions Follow Global Operation Against Lockbit Group

Europol and multiple countries have taken a significant step against the notorious Lockbit ransomware group with four key arrests and international sanctions. A collaborative effort between France, the UK, and Spain led to the detainment of critical individuals, including a developer and a hosting administrator.
